Dog Apparel Size Guide
Getting the right fit makes all the difference in keeping your dog comfortable and looking their best. Since sizing can vary between styles, we recommend measuring your dog before every purchase rather than going by their previous size.
How to Measure Your Dog
- Back Length: Measure from the base of the neck (where the collar sits) to the base of the tail along the spine.
- Chest: Measure around the widest part of the chest, just behind the front legs.
- Neck: Measure around the middle of the neck where the collar typically sits.
If your dog's measurements fall between two sizes, we recommend sizing up for a more comfortable fit.
Sweater Sizing
Our dog sweaters are sized by back length and weight. Use the chart below to find the best fit for your pup. Suggested breeds are provided as a general guide. Individual dogs may vary.
| Size | Back Length (inches) | Weight Range (lbs) | Suggested Breeds |
|---|---|---|---|
| XS | 12-13 | 5-10 | Yorkie, Toy Poodle, Maltese |
| S | 15-17 | 10-18 | Jack Russell, Dachshund |
| M | 19-21 | 18-29 | Beagle, Pug, Cocker Spaniel |
| L | 23-25 | 29-40 | Border Collie, Bull Terrier |
| XL | 27-29 | 40-60 | Labrador, Dalmatian, Pit Bull |
| 2XL | 30-33 | 60-80 | Rottweiler, German Shepherd, Boxer |
| 3XL | 36-38 | 80-120 | Great Dane, Greyhound |
